How To Fix R1833 - Text for relationship type &1 does not exist in language &2


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: R1 - Business Partner Messages from S_BUPA_GENERAL

  • Message number: 833

  • Message text: Text for relationship type &1 does not exist in language &2

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message R1833 - Text for relationship type &1 does not exist in language &2 ?

    The SAP error message R1833, which states "Text for relationship type &1 does not exist in language &2," typically occurs in the context of SAP's master data management, particularly when dealing with relationships between different objects (like business partners, materials, etc.). This error indicates that the system is trying to access a text description for a specific relationship type, but it cannot find it in the specified language.

    Cause:

    1. Missing Text Entries: The primary cause of this error is that the text for the specified relationship type (denoted by &1) is not maintained in the specified language (denoted by &2) in the system.
    2. Incorrect Language Settings: The language settings in the user profile or the system configuration may not match the available texts.
    3. Data Inconsistency: There may be inconsistencies in the data where the relationship type is defined but lacks the necessary text entries.

    Solution:

    1. Maintain Text for Relationship Type:

      • Go to the relevant transaction code (e.g., BP for Business Partner) where you can maintain the relationship types.
      • Navigate to the section where you can maintain texts for relationship types.
      • Ensure that the text for the relationship type in the specified language is created and saved.
    2. Check Language Settings:

      • Verify the language settings in your user profile. Make sure that the language you are using is supported and that the texts exist for that language.
      • You can check your user settings in the SAP GUI by navigating to System -> User Profile -> Own Data.
    3. Use Transaction Codes:

      • You can use transaction codes like SE11 (Data Dictionary) or SE78 (SAP ArchiveLink) to check the underlying tables and see if the texts are missing.
      • If you have access, you can also use SE63 to maintain translations for texts in different languages.
